WordPress: Δυναμική μετα-περιγραφή σε κάθε ανάρτηση

SEO Βελτιστοποίηση μηχανών αναζήτησης

Η προεπιλεγμένη κεφαλίδα WordPress καθορίζει μια μεμονωμένη περιγραφή οποιασδήποτε σελίδας του ιστότοπού σας, ανεξάρτητα από τη σελίδα στην οποία προσγειώθηκε κάποιος από μια μηχανή αναζήτησης. Ότι η περιγραφή στη μηχανή αναζήτησης ενδέχεται να μην περιγράφει πραγματικά την ανάρτηση που βρίσκεται στο ιστολόγιο μπορεί να έχει ως αποτέλεσμα λιγότερα άτομα να κάνουν κλικ στον σύνδεσμό σας.

Δεν το σκέφτηκα ποτέ μέχρι αυτό το Σαββατοκύριακο όταν έλαβα την ακόλουθη κριτική του ιστοτόπου μου από το BlogStorm:

Ωραίο, εύκολο να συνδέσεις το δόλωμα! Δοκιμάστε να προσθέσετε μερικά κοινωνικά κουμπιά σελιδοδείκτη στο κάτω μέρος των δημοσιεύσεών σας και μερικές μοναδικές μετα-περιγραφές σε κάθε σελίδα.

Η δημιουργία εσόδων από ένα blog σαν αυτό είναι δύσκολο, αν δοκιμάσετε τα πάντα John Chow έχει δοκιμάσει τότε θα είστε στο σωστό δρόμο.

Με κάποια φαντασία και πολλά δολώματα συνδέσμων, θα είστε σε θέση να λάβετε αρκετούς συνδέσμους για να ταξινομήσετε για μερικούς πολύ καλούς όρους (ίσως έχετε ήδη). Μόλις κατατάξετε αυτούς τους όρους, μπορείτε να κολλήσετε συνδέσμους συνεργατών και Adsense στις σελίδες και να αποκομίσετε τα κέρδη.

Ο έλεγχος του ιστότοπού σας είναι φανταστικό, διότι συχνά εντοπίζει κάποιο πρόβλημα με τον ιστότοπό σας στο οποίο δεν προσέχετε. Σε αυτήν την περίπτωση, είναι η περιγραφή της μετα-ετικέτας μου για καθεμία από τις αναρτήσεις μου. Οι μετα-περιγραφές χρησιμοποιούνται από τις μηχανές αναζήτησης για να εφαρμόσουν μια σύντομη περιγραφή της σελίδας που αναφέρεται στα αποτελέσματα. Επειδή οι χρήστες θα βλέπουν διαφορετικές σελίδες όταν σας αναζητούν, γιατί να μην εφαρμόσετε διαφορετικές μετα-περιγραφές για καθεμία από τις σελίδες σας;

Έχω ήδη τροποποιήσει την κεφαλίδα μου για να συμπεριλάβω δυναμικές λέξεις-κλειδιά για τη μετα-ετικέτα λέξεων-κλειδιών μου και βοήθησε στη βελτίωση της κατάταξης ορισμένων από τις αναρτήσεις μου. Η εφαρμογή διαφορετικών περιγραφών μπορεί να μην αυξήσει τη θέση μου στην αναζήτηση, αλλά όπως επισημαίνει το BlogStorm - θα μπορούσε να οδηγήσει σε μεγαλύτερη αλληλεπίδραση με τις σελίδες μου από τα αποτελέσματα της αναζήτησης ατόμων.

Περιγραφή της Λύσης

Εάν η σελίδα στον ιστότοπό μου είναι μία σελίδα, όπως όταν κάνετε κλικ σε μία ανάρτηση, θέλετε ένα απόσπασμα της σελίδας. Θέλω το απόσπασμα να είναι οι πρώτες 20 έως 25 λέξεις της ανάρτησης, αλλά πρέπει να φιλτράρω οτιδήποτε HTML. Ευτυχώς, WordPress έχει μια λειτουργία που θα μου παρέχει αυτό που χρειάζομαι, το_excerpt_rss. Αν και δεν προοριζόταν για αυτήν τη χρήση, είναι ένας έξυπνος τρόπος να εφαρμόσετε το όριο λέξεων και να αφαιρέσετε όλα τα στοιχεία HTML!

Θα μπορούσα ακόμη και να το κάνω ένα βήμα παραπέρα και να χρησιμοποιήσω το Προαιρετικό απόσπασμα μέσα στο WordPress για να συμπληρώσετε τη μετα-περιγραφή, αλλά προς το παρόν αυτή είναι μια ωραία τακτοποιημένη συντόμευση! (Εάν χρησιμοποιήσετε αυτήν την προσέγγιση ΚΑΙ εισαγάγετε ένα προαιρετικό απόσπασμα, θα χρησιμοποιήσει αυτό το απόσπασμα για τη μετα-περιγραφή).

Ο κωδικός κεφαλίδας

Αυτή η λειτουργία απαιτεί να την καλέσετε στο The Loop, οπότε υπάρχει κάποια πολυπλοκότητα σε αυτήν:

"/>

ΣΗΜΕΊΩΣΗ: Φροντίστε να αντικαταστήσετε το "Η προεπιλεγμένη περιγραφή μου" με ό, τι έχετε αυτήν τη στιγμή ή θέλετε ως μετα-περιγραφή του ιστολογίου σας.

Αυτό που κάνει αυτός ο κώδικας είναι να παρέχει την προεπιλεγμένη μετα-περιγραφή για το ιστολόγιό σας οπουδήποτε, αλλά σε μια σελίδα με μία ανάρτηση, οπότε παίρνει τις πρώτες 20 λέξεις και αφαιρεί όλο το HTML από αυτό. Θα συνεχίσω να τελειοποιώ τον κώδικα (αφαίρεση γραμμής τροφοδοσίας) και ενσωματώνοντας μια «δήλωση if» εάν υπάρχει προαιρετικό απόσπασμα. Μείνετε συντονισμένοι!